用git怎么从分支下代码

不及物动词 其他 46

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    使用Git从分支下拉代码需要以下步骤:
    1. 确定当前的工作目录,这个目录应该是你本地代码仓库的根目录。使用`cd`命令进入到该目录下。
    2. 使用`git branch`命令查看当前所有的分支,确认你要拉取代码的分支。
    3. 使用`git checkout`命令切换到你要拉取代码的分支。例如,`git checkout branch_name`,其中`branch_name`是你要切换的分支名称。
    4. 使用`git pull origin branch_name`命令拉取代码,并将代码合并到当前分支。其中,`branch_name`是你要拉取的分支名称。
    5. 如果有冲突,需要手动解决冲突。打开冲突文件,在文件中解决冲突,然后保存文件。
    6. 使用`git add`命令将解决冲突后的文件添加到暂存区。
    7. 使用`git commit`命令提交修改到本地仓库。
    8. 如果有需要,可以将本地仓库的代码推送到远程仓库,使用`git push`命令。
    以上就是使用Git从分支下拉代码的步骤。注意,这些步骤是在假设你已经配置好了远程仓库并且有权限访问。如果你是第一次使用,请先配置好远程仓库的信息。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    从一个分支获取代码的基本步骤如下:

    1. 确保你已经在本地克隆了仓库。如果没有,你可以使用以下命令克隆一个仓库:

    “`
    git clone [仓库URL]
    “`

    2. 使用以下命令查看所有可用的分支:

    “`
    git branch
    “`

    3. 使用以下命令切换到你想要获取代码的分支:

    “`
    git checkout [分支名]
    “`

    4. 确认你已经切换到了正确的分支,使用以下命令查看当前分支:

    “`
    git branch
    “`

    5. 现在你可以获取分支下的代码了。你可以使用以下命令将远程分支的代码拉取到本地:

    “`
    git pull origin [远程分支名]:[本地分支名]
    “`

    例如,如果你想要获取名为`feature`的远程分支的代码并将其拉取到本地的`feature`分支,可以使用以下命令:

    “`
    git pull origin feature:feature
    “`

    6. 等待拉取过程完成后,你就成功获取了分支下的代码。你可以通过在文件系统中查看文件来确认代码是否已成功获取。

    值得注意的是,如果你已经在本地创建了一个与远程分支同名的分支,你可以省略`:[本地分支名]`这一部分。例如,如果你已经在本地创建了一个名为`feature`的分支,可以使用以下命令拉取远程`feature`分支的代码:

    “`
    git pull origin feature
    “`

    另外,如果你想要将远程分支的代码合并到当前分支而不是拉取到一个新的本地分支,可以使用`git merge`命令。只需切换到目标分支,然后执行以下命令:

    “`
    git merge [远程分支名]
    “`

    这将在当前分支上合并远程分支的代码。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    从分支拉取代码是Git中常见的操作之一。下面是详细的操作流程:

    1. 首先,检查当前所在分支。使用以下命令查看当前所在分支:
    “`
    git branch
    “`
    当前分支会在命令行中以特殊标识(通常是一个*号)显示出来。

    2. 如果不在目标分支上,先切换到目标分支。可以使用以下命令切换分支:
    “`
    git checkout <目标分支名>
    “`
    这里的`<目标分支名>`是你想要切换到的分支的名称。

    3. 当你确定在目标分支上后,可以使用以下命令拉取分支上的代码:
    “`
    git pull origin <目标分支名>
    “`
    这里的`<目标分支名>`是你想要从中拉取代码的分支的名称。`origin`是默认的远程仓库名称,如果你使用了其他名称,请将之替换。

    4. 如果分支上有新的提交,Git会自动将它们合并到本地分支上。如果合并过程出现冲突,需要手动解决冲突。在解决完冲突后,可以使用以下命令将合并的结果提交到本地仓库:
    “`
    git commit -m “Merge branch ‘<目标分支名>‘ into <本地分支名>”
    “`
    这里的`<目标分支名>`是你拉取代码的分支的名称,`<本地分支名>`是你当前所在的本地分支的名称。

    5. 最后,如果你想将本地的提交推送到远程仓库,可以使用以下命令进行推送:
    “`
    git push origin <本地分支名>
    “`
    这里的`<本地分支名>`是你想要推送到远程仓库的本地分支的名称。

    总结:从分支下拉取代码的过程是先切换到目标分支,然后使用`git pull`命令拉取最新的代码,解决冲突并提交本地仓库,最后将本地提交推送到远程仓库。注意,在拉取代码之前,确保你的本地仓库是干净的,没有未提交的更改。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部